Protecting the Lives of Mäori babies
Service Overview
What do we do?
We provide education and training packages focused on strengthening the workforce to support Māori families reduce the risk of SUDI to their babies. Our programmes are tailored to meet the needs of stakeholders. Training packages range from lectures, small and large group discussions, half day and full day workshops.
The new focus of our Education and Training service is to work with other providers who deliver education to our target audiences, and support them to incorporate Maori SIDS Modules into their existing education programmes.

Who can do our training?
Our programmes target anyone who engages with Māori families and has an opportunity to influence and support their parenting practices. Previous participants have included general practitioners (GPs), practice and community nurses, lead maternity carers (LMCs) community health workers, Plunket and Tamariki ora nurses, Māori community health workers and other allied workers.
